Analysing Soil Structure and Quality
Soil composition fundamentally determines a pitch’s performance characteristics and long-term sustainability. Cricket groundskeepers must evaluate soil texture, made up of sand, silt, and clay particles in specific proportions. The ideal cricket pitch usually demands well-drained loamy earth with adequate organic matter content. Consistent soil testing detects imbalanced nutrient levels, pH variations, and compaction issues needing corrective measures. This technical knowledge enables groundskeepers to carry out focused soil enhancement schemes, preserving ideal circumstances for turf development and consistent pitch performance during the entire season.
Soil health covers biological, chemical, and physical properties operating in concert to support vigorous grass development. Groundskeepers track microbial populations, earthworm numbers, and organic decomposition rates, understanding these indicators indicate overall soil vitality. Introducing sustainable approaches such as aeration, top-dressing using quality compost, and strategic irrigation improves soil structure and water retention. By focusing on soil health through scientific management practices, groundskeepers develop robust playing surfaces able to endure heavy use whilst preserving the exact playing standards demanded by professional cricket.
- Soil pH levels need to be monitored regularly between 6.0 and 7.0
- Organic matter content should constitute roughly 5-8 percent
- Drainage rates must exceed 25mm/hour
- Nutrient profiles demand balanced nitrogen, phosphorus, and potassium
- Compaction assessment prevents root development and waterlogging issues

Qualifications and Ongoing Development
Formal qualifications in groundsmanship deliver foundational knowledge crucial to pitch management proficiency. The Level 3 National Diploma in Sports Turf Management and comparable qualifications furnish practitioners with comprehensive understanding of soil structure, grass variety choice, and maintenance protocols. These courses integrate academic study with hands-on practice, ensuring graduates demonstrate practical proficiency. Validation by established authorities validates professional competency and shows commitment to industry standards, significantly enhancing professional advancement opportunities and professional credibility within the sport.
